Output c99e42b6af0b40a3a043f21b087839d0445f3a9456cba81fe04d843be2ab59cf:0

value
21696896
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ba3a8df66d9f9487000089d93ca7992f3a90ae1f5d4b825b8719fe3c4cb7b89e
address
bc1phgagmandn72gwqqq38vnefue9uafptslt49cyku8r8lrcn9hhz0qszp8my
transaction
c99e42b6af0b40a3a043f21b087839d0445f3a9456cba81fe04d843be2ab59cf
spent
true